Baines links up with England?

Everton defender Leighton Baines has reportedly joined up with his England teammates at St George's Park.

The 29-year-old has been strongly linked with a move to Manchester United for the majority of the summer, although Everton manager Roberto Martinez has insisted that the full-back is not for sale.

The fact that he has travelled to meet up with the national team would suggest that a transfer is not imminent, but manager Roy Hodgson would allow him to leave the camp if the chance of a transfer materialises, according to the Daily Mail.

United are also believed to be keen on Baines's club colleague Marouane Fellaini.
